CHEN Xudong is in the third month of his cleaning job at a McDonald’s in northern Beijing. The 19-year-old busses tables, clearing leftovers into waste bins in the corner, on the go all the time. His aptness makes it hard to imagine the difficulties he had getting this far in life.
